The boy being beaten, and the guidance counselor's response, are based on the experience of a friend of my son. In his Junior year, in a school in WV, he was verbally abused daily. Finally, when he had his nose and finger broken by another student, his mother decided that she would drive him the 20 miles to the only other high school in the county. The students who physically assaulted him were on the football team, and as such, were never reprimanded. The guidance counselor did reprimand my son for speaking out against this injustice. I've never been more proud of my son, and more ashamed of the school that I graduated from.
